Nuclear Power: A Deeper Understanding

Nuclear power is a method of generating electricity that utilizes the process of nuclear fission, where the nucleus of an atom is split into two or more smaller, lighter nuclei. This process releases a significant amount of energy, which is then harnessed to produce electricity. The primary fuel used in nuclear fission is uranium, a naturally occurring element that is mined from the earth.

Renewable vs. Non-Renewable Resources

The distinction between renewable and non-renewable resources hinges on the ability of the resource to be replenished naturally within a human timescale. Renewable resources, such as solar power, wind energy, and hydroelectric power, are those that are continuously replenished by natural processes. They are considered sustainable because they do not deplete the earth's resources and can be used indefinitely.

On the other hand, non-renewable resources are those that cannot be replenished within a reasonable timeframe. They are finite and will eventually run out if consumed continuously. Examples include fossil fuels like coal, oil, and natural gas, as well as minerals and metals that are mined from the earth.

Uranium and the Debate

The crux of the debate regarding nuclear power as a renewable resource centers around uranium. Uranium, as mentioned, is a non-renewable resource because it is a finite mineral that cannot be replenished on a human timescale. However, the amount of energy that can be extracted from a given amount of uranium is substantial, and nuclear power plants are designed to be highly efficient in their use of this fuel.

Some argue that the high energy density of nuclear power, along with advancements in nuclear technology such as breeder reactors, which can extend the life of nuclear fuel by converting non-fissile uranium into fissile plutonium, make nuclear power a more sustainable option compared to fossil fuels. Additionally, the waste produced by nuclear power, while radioactive and requiring careful management, is significantly less in volume compared to the waste generated by fossil fuel combustion.

Environmental Impact and Sustainability

The environmental impact of nuclear power is another critical aspect to consider. Nuclear power plants emit no greenhouse gases during operation, making them a low-carbon source of energy. This is a significant advantage in the fight against climate change. However, the construction of nuclear power plants, the mining of uranium, and the management of nuclear waste all have environmental implications that must be carefully managed.

Nuclear power plants use nuclear fission to create electricity. The fuel that nuclear power plants use for nuclear fission is uranium. Unlike solar power and wind energy, uranium is a non-renewable resource.
